Job description

Job Title: Diagnostic Technician

Location: Vancouver, British Columbia

Type: Direct Hire

Contractor Work Model: Onsite

Job Profile Summary

We are looking for a skilled and hands‑on technician to support client operations in Canada and the USA. This role focuses on diagnostics, repairs, and technical support for client vehicles, ensuring high service quality and customer satisfaction. The ideal candidate will have strong mechanical and electrical expertise, experience with digital tools, and a proactive approach to problem‑solving. A valid bus driver’s license is mandatory to perform vehicle‑related tasks and support operational needs.

Key Responsibilities
1. Technical Diagnostics & Repairs
  • Perform in‑depth diagnostics and repair of complex mechanical, electrical, and software‑related issues on vehicles.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ues identified during Pre‑Delivery Inspections (PDI), pilot tests, or reported by customers.
  • Document root causes and corrective actions for recurring or critical issues.
2. Technical Support
  • Act as the first line of technical support for customer‑reported issues.
  • Collaborate with client technical teams to elevate and resolve complex problems.
  • Support the coordination of suppliers when needed.
3. Spare Parts & Logistics Support
  • Identify required spare parts for repairs.
  • Assist in parts inventory, ensuring availability of critical components.
  • Support the return and shipment of defective parts, ensuring proper documentation.
4. Digital Tools & Documentation
  • Use platforms like eSNote and eSClaim to document repairs, track issues, and support cost settlement processes.
  • Maintain accurate service records, including photos, diagnostics logs, and repair reports.
  • Provide feedback on digital tool usability and suggest improvements.
  • Support the introduction and implementation of IT tools (e.g., Business Central) for managing spare parts ordering, with a focus on improving efficiency and traceability.
5. Customer Interaction
  • Support customer visits or remote diagnostics sessions by explaining technical issues and solutions.
  • Provide on‑site technical assistance during critical repairs or escalations.
6. Continuous Improvement & Feedback
  • Share insights on recurring issues to support root cause analysis and preventive actions.
  • Participate in internal technical reviews and knowledge‑sharing sessions.
  • Suggest improvements to repair procedures, tools, and documentation practices.
Qualifications
  • Technical diploma or degree in Mechanics, Electrical Engineering, Automotive Technology, or related field.
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in vehicle diagnostics and repair, preferably in the bus or commercial vehicle sector.
  • Strong understanding of mechanical, electrical, and software systems in modern vehicles.
  • Experience with digital platforms for service documentation and diagnostics.
  • Valid bus driver’s license is mandatory.
  • Fluent in English; Polish is a plus.
Skills & Competencies
  • Technical Expertise: Strong diagnostic and repair skills across mechanical, electrical, and software domains.
  • Problem Solving: Ability to identify root causes and implement effective solutions.
  • Digital Literacy: Comfortable using service platforms and ERP systems for documentation and parts management.
  • Customer Orientation: Professional and clear communication with customers during technical support.
  • Team Collaboration: Works effectively with HQ, suppliers, and customers.
  • Flexibility: Willingness to travel across Canada, the USA, and occasionally to Europe for training or support missions.
  • Documentation: Accurate and thorough record‑keeping of service activities and technical issues.
